Baseball Recap: Racine Park Panthers vs. Racine Case Eagles

Racine Park was not able to break out of their rough patch on Tuesday as the team picked up their fifth straight defeat. They fell just short of the Racine Case Eagles by a score of 4-3. The result was an unpleasant reminder to Racine Park of the 16-4 loss they experienced in the pair's previous head-to-head fixture back in April of 2023.

CY Charles made the most of his time at bat despite the final result and scored a run and stole five bases while going 1-for-2.

On Racine Case's side, they got a big performance out of Griffin Meisterheim, who went 2-for-2 with two doubles, a stolen base, and an RBI. Meisterheim is crushing it when it comes to stolen bases: he's stolen at least one every time he's taken the field this season. The team also got some help courtesy of Julian Chavez-anderson, who scored a run and stole a base while going 1-for-2.

Racine Park's defeat dropped their record down to 1-9. As for Racine Case, their win bumped their record up to 2-7.

While Racine Park had to take the loss, they won't have to wait long to give it another shot: the pair's next game is a rematch scheduled at 4:30 p.m. on Wednesday.
